Transaction 16ecb9f5e66877e9a1f8f46538e71f20d13cf156b8331573ff5db7c44b4f1a82

1 Input
1 Outputs
  • 16ecb9f5e66877e9a1f8f46538e71f20d13cf156b8331573ff5db7c44b4f1a82:0
  • value  1313036221
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Y